The is an Allwinner-based Android head unit commonly found in aftermarket car stereos. Updates for this specific model typically fall into three categories: system software, MCU (Microcontroller Unit), and Canbus firmware. Update Methods Online OTA Update : Go to Settings > System > System Upgrade .

The K2501-t5 processor requires a cleanly formatted storage drive to recognize system packages during bootup. Insert a USB flash drive (8GB to 32GB) into a computer. Right-click the drive and choose . Select FAT32 as the file system. Perform a full format to wipe all existing partitions. If the CarPlay menu disappears from your apps list after updating, open , select Factory Settings , and enter your manufacturer passcode (common defaults include 1234 , 8888 , or 16176699 ). Scroll down to the structural feature flags list, verify that the CarPlay/ZLINK toggle is turned on, and tap Save in the top right corner to restart the system with the feature enabled.
